About the Role

We are delighted to be supporting Brunswick Surgery with their recruitment for a salaried GP.

We are looking for a motivated and forward thinking GP to join the friendly and enthusiastic teaching practice, working from purpose-built award winning premises.

Situated in leafy Surbiton, Southwest London, Brunswick is located within easy reach of central London, the A3 and M25.

Main duties of the job
  • The delivery of highly effective medical care to the entitled population
  • The provision of services commensurate with the primary care contract
  • Generic prescribing adhering to local and national guidance
  • Effective management of long-term conditions
  • Processing of administration in a timely manner, including referrals, repeat prescription requests and other associated administrative tasks
  • On a rotational basis, undertake telephone triage and duty doctor roles
  • Maintain accurate clinical records in conjunction with good practice, policy and guidance
  • Work collaboratively, accepting an equal share of the practice workload
  • Adhere to best practice recommended through clinical guidelines and the audit process
  • Contribute to the successful implementation of continuous improvement and quality initiatives within the practice
  • Accept delegated responsibility for a specific area (or areas) or the QOF
  • Attend and contribute effectively to practice meetings as required
  • Contribute effective to the development and maintenance of the practice including clinical governance and training
  • Ensure compliance with the appraisal/check-in process
  • Prepare and complete the revalidation process
  • Commit to self-learning and instil an ethos of continuing professional development across the practice team.
  • Support the training of medical students from all clinical disciplines
  • Support the partners in achieving the strategic aims of the practice, making recommendations to enhance income and reduce expenditure
